AMAT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2026 in Review

3,483 of the 8,274 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Applied Materials (AMAT) for Q2 2026, worth a combined $475B — up 117% from $219B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 708 funds opened new AMAT positions and 116 closed out — a net gain of 592 holders — while 1,075 added to existing stakes and 1,338 trimmed.

The largest buyer was JP Morgan Chase, adding an estimated $4.13B. The largest seller was Capital Research Global Investors, cutting an estimated $3.37B.
